Three Serie A clubs want to sign Liverpool striker
Liverpool striker Divock Origi is attracting interest from three Serie A clubs, according to Sky Sports News.
The Belgian is a fan favourite among Reds fans following his Champions League heroics against Barcelona in 2019.
Despite this, he has never been a regular starter under Jurgen Klopp, and he could leave on a free transfer in the summer.
His current contract expires in six months' time. As many as three Serie A clubs are interested in negotiating a pre-contract.
The 26-year-old is aware of the situation, but he would prefer to continue in the Premier League with another club next season.
West Ham United and Aston Villa have been linked with him in the past, and the former are still searching for a new striker.
Flamengo's Gabriel Barbosa has been identified as their prime target, but the Brazilian side only prefer a straight-cash deal.
They could revive their interest in Origi, but the Reds are highly unlikely to sanction his departure midway through the season.
The Merseyside giants could be without Mohamed Salah and Sadio Mane for the whole month due to the African Cup of Nations.
